Arduino is an open-source electronics platform that can be used to create interactive objects by artists, hobbyists, and anyone interested in building hardware projects. It uses easy to use hardware and software that abstracts complex tasks. The Arduino board is based around a microcontroller and can be programmed using the Arduino IDE which supports Windows, MacOS, and Linux. It has gained popularity with over 250,000 boards sold, empowering a global community of makers and coders to create projects for areas like robotics, home automation, and IoT.
